As a fighter pilot in Korea who flew 100 combat missions, I’ve always felt a little uneasy about a society that can deify a thinly credentialed portrayer of war, yet can just as easily relegate the memory of 50,000 Americans who died in Korea to an almost forgotten footnote in history.
Write on, Miles Corwin.
VICTOR M. MATLOFF
Corone del Mar
